Meijer Announces May 14 as Opening Date for New Supercenters in Alliance and North Canton

April 9, 2024 Meijer

Meijer announced it will open two new 159,000-square-foot supercenters in Alliance and North Canton, Ohio, on May 14, increasing the retailer’s store count to 55 in the state.

Zebra Technologies Launches New Sustainability Partner Recognition Program Globally

April 9, 2024 Zebra Technologies

Too Good To Go, the social impact company behind the world’s largest marketplace for surplus food, is the first to qualify as a recognized Zebra Sustainability Partner. The Too Good To Go Platform, its end-to-end surplus food management solution, allows grocery retailers to unlock value from excess inventory and reduce food waste.

FPAA Celebrates a Triumphant Spring Policy Summit on US-Mexico and Canada Trade Relations

The Fresh Produce Association of the Americas has just concluded a successful Spring Policy Summit. This gathering that brought together over 100 key players to delve into the complexities of US, Mexico, and Canada trade and agricultural practices. In a period marked by political transitions, the upcoming renegotiation of the USMCA, and the uncertainty surrounding the tomato suspension agreement, this summit helped to shine a light on the complex nature of commerce and policy between our nations.
